Choosing Your Sweats
Picking the right sweatpants is a very big step for this look. Not all sweats are equal when it comes to pairing them with heels. You want something that looks a bit more polished. This means looking at the fabric and how they fit. You also want to think about the color.
Fabric and Fit
Look for sweatpants made from better materials. Think about a thicker cotton blend. Or maybe even a cashmere mix. These fabrics tend to drape better. They look less like gym clothes. They feel more like proper trousers. A smooth finish is good, so. Avoid anything too fuzzy or worn out.
The fit is also very important. A slim or tapered leg often works best. This creates a clean line down to your heels. Baggy sweats can overwhelm the look. They might make you appear shorter. A cuff at the ankle can be good. It lets you show off your shoes. It keeps the pants from dragging on the ground.
Some sweatpants have a slight pleat or seam down the front. These details can make them look more structured. They give them a more tailored feel. This helps bridge the gap between casual and dressy. It is a subtle touch that makes a big difference.
Color Matters
Darker colors usually look more sophisticated. Black, charcoal gray, or deep navy are good choices. They can make the outfit seem more formal. Lighter colors like cream or light gray can work too. But they need to be very clean and well-kept. A bright color might be a bit much. It could make the outfit look less refined.
Neutral colors are often the safest bet. They let your heels or top stand out. They provide a calm base for the rest of your outfit. This allows for more freedom with other pieces. It is a simple way to keep the look balanced.
Picking the Right Heels
The type of heel you choose can totally change the vibe of your outfit. You want a heel that adds polish. It should also feel right with the relaxed nature of the sweats. There are a few good options to consider.
Stiletto or Block?
Stiletto heels offer a very sharp, dressy contrast. They make your legs look longer. They add a lot of elegance to the casual pants. This is a good choice for a night out. It makes the outfit feel more intentional. It is a bold statement, that.
Block heels are a bit more comfortable. They still give you height. They offer more stability. This can be a good option for daytime events. Or for when you will be on your feet more. They give a modern, strong look. They can make the outfit feel a little more grounded.
Pointed-toe heels generally work well. They create a sleek line. They help lengthen your leg. Open-toe heels, like strappy sandals, can also be good. They add a touch of lightness. This can be nice for warmer weather. Just make sure your pedicure is ready, of course.
Ankle Boots and Heels
Heeled ankle boots are another strong contender. They look very chic with tapered sweatpants. The boot shaft can disappear under the pant cuff. This creates a continuous line. It is a good option for cooler weather. It adds a bit of edge to the look.
A boot with a sharp toe can really complete the outfit. It adds a sophisticated touch. This makes the sweatpants feel less like loungewear. It makes them feel more like part of a fashion-forward ensemble. You can really get a lot of mileage out of a good pair of heeled boots.
Styling Your Outfit
Once you have your sweats and heels, it is time to think about the rest of the outfit. This is where you can really make the look your own. It is about balancing the casual with the refined.
Monochromatic Magic
Wearing sweats and a top in the same color can make the outfit look more expensive. It creates a long, lean line. This trick works very well with black or gray sweats. It gives a polished feel. You can then add a pop of color with your shoes or a bag. This makes the look cohesive and chic.
A matching sweat set, top and bottom, can be a great starting point. It takes the guesswork out of pairing. You just add your heels. This creates an effortless, yet put-together, appearance. It is a simple way to look stylish.
Layering for Depth
Adding layers can give your outfit more interest. A long coat or a blazer over your top can really elevate the look. It adds structure. It makes the sweatpants seem more intentional. A trench coat, for instance, can make the whole outfit feel very sophisticated.
A denim jacket or a leather jacket can add a cool, casual edge. These pieces balance the dressiness of the heels. They make the outfit feel more relaxed. It is about finding the right mix. You want something that complements the overall vibe.
Adding Accessories
Accessories are key to making this look work. A structured handbag can instantly dress up the outfit. Think about a sleek clutch or a small shoulder bag. This contrasts with the casualness of the sweats. It adds a touch of elegance.
Jewelry can also make a big difference. Delicate necklaces or hoop earrings can add sparkle. They draw attention to your face. A statement belt can cinch your waist. It gives shape to the outfit. It breaks up the line of the sweats.
Sunglasses can add a cool, mysterious touch. A chic scarf can bring color and texture. These small details really pull the whole look together. They show you have thought about your style.
Top Choices
For your top, consider something that feels a bit more refined than a basic t-shirt. A crisp white button-down shirt can look very smart. It creates a nice contrast with the sweats. You can leave it untucked for a relaxed feel. Or you can tuck it in for a more polished look.
A silk camisole or a fitted knit top also works well. These pieces add a touch of luxury. They balance the casual nature of the sweatpants. A simple, well-made sweater can also be a good choice. It adds warmth and texture. It keeps the outfit feeling comfortable.
A graphic tee can be fun. But make sure it is a good quality one. Pair it with a blazer to keep the look elevated. It is about mixing high and low pieces. This is what makes the sweats with heels trend so interesting.
